CentOS 6.2系统升级yum源教程

5星 · 超过95%的资源 需积分: 9 29 下载量 98 浏览量 更新于2024-09-14 收藏 18KB DOCX 举报
"这篇文章主要介绍了如何在 CentOS 6.2 操作系统中更新 yum 源,以便获取最新的软件包和安全更新。" 在 CentOS 6.2 中,yum 是默认的包管理器,用于安装、升级和管理系统的软件包。随着时间的推移,旧的 yum 源可能不再提供最新的软件或安全更新,因此定期更新 yum 源至关重要。以下是详细的步骤来更新 CentOS 6.2 的 yum 源: 1. 备份现有 yum 配置: 在开始更改之前,通常建议备份现有的 yum 配置文件以防万一。这可以通过运行以下命令完成: ``` mv /etc/yum.repos.d/CentOS-Base.repo{,.bak} ``` 这会将 `CentOS-Base.repo` 文件重命名为 `CentOS-Base.repo.bak`,作为备份。 2. 编辑 yum 配置文件: 使用 vi 或你喜欢的文本编辑器(如 nano)打开 `CentOS-Base.repo` 文件: ``` vi /etc/yum.repos.d/CentOS-Base.repo ``` 在这个文件中,你需要找到并更新镜像源的信息。 3. 替换默认镜像源: 文件中列出了多个 `[repository]` 部分,例如 `[base]` 和 `[updates]`。对于每个部分,你需要更改 `mirrorlist` 或 `baseurl` 的值。在这个例子中,我们将使用网易的镜像源: - 对于 `[base]` 部分: ``` baseurl=http://mirrors.163.com/centos/$releasever/os/$basearch/ ``` - 对于 `[updates]` 部分: ``` baseurl=http://mirrors.163.com/centos/$releasever/updates/$basearch/ ``` 这些 URL 指向了网易提供的 CentOS 6.2 镜像,它们提供了与官方相同的软件包,但可能速度更快,因为它们位于更接近你的地理位置。 4. 验证 GPG 密钥: 文件中的 `gpgcheck` 参数设置为 1,这意味着系统会在安装软件包前验证其签名。确保 `gpgkey` 的值正确指向 CentOS 的 GPG 密钥: ``` g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-CentOS-6 ``` 如果你的系统尚未导入这个密钥,可以使用 `rpm --import` 命令导入: ``` rpm --import /etc/pki/rpm-gpg/RPM-GPG-KEY-CentOS-6 ``` 5. 保存并关闭文件: 在编辑器中完成更改后,记得保存文件并退出。 6. 更新缓存: 最后,运行以下命令更新 yum 的软件包列表: ``` yum clean all yum makecache ``` 7. 检查更新: 现在你可以检查是否有可用的更新: ``` yum check-update ``` 8. 安装更新: 如果发现有可用更新,使用 `yum update` 命令进行安装: ``` yum update ``` 通过这些步骤,你已经成功地为 CentOS 6.2 更新了 yum 源,现在你可以继续使用新的源来获取最新的软件包和安全更新。记得定期检查和应用这些更新,以保持系统的安全性和稳定性。